Loughner’s Fixaton on Giffords Goes Back to 2007

John on January 9, 2011 at 1:44 pm

Dave Weigel has the court filing which indicates Loughner had fixated on Giffords, possibly as early as 2007:

Some of the evidence seized from that located included a letter in a safe, addressed to “Mr. Jared Loughney” at 7741 N. Soledad Avenue, from Congresswoman Giffords, on Congressional stationary, dated August 30, 2007, thanking him for attending a “Congress on your Corner” event at the Foothills Mall in Tuscon. Also recovered in the safe was an envelope with handwriting on the envelope stating “I planned ahead,” and “My assassination,” and the name “Giffords,” along with what appears to be Loughner’s signature.

Loughner’s former friend Caitie Parker remembers him meeting Giffords and later told her he thought Giffords was “stupid.” It’s possible that the letter from 2007 only later developed into an assassination plan, but at the very least there is now solid reason to believe Loughner had an unhealthy fixation on Giffords since well before anyone outside of Alaska had heard of Sarah Palin and about 18 months before the existence of the Tea Party. His reasons were probably his own.
